What Does Central Theme Of A Story Mean . The theme of a story is the central element of its narrative. Serving as the backbone of a story, the theme of a story ties together all of its elements. The theme of a story is the central idea, message, or underlying meaning that the author wants to convey. Short stories often have just one theme,. It is the underlying message that the author wants to convey to the reader. The theme of a story is the story’s central point. Theme is defined as a main idea or an underlying meaning of a literary work which is conveyed by an author and interpreted by a reader. A theme also works as a catalyst to bring together different narratives in one plot. The theme of a story is what the author is trying to convey — in other words, the central idea of the story.
